Gerald Strang

Gerald Strang was an American composer who later in life turned to electronic and computer music. Early in his career he worked with Arnold Schoenberg as a teaching assistant and became one of the disciples of Schoenberg's American period.

Selected works
Eleven, for piano (1931) • Mirrorrorrim, palindrome for piano (1931) • Clarinet Sonatina (1932) • Clarinet Quintet (1933) • String Quartet (1934) • Percussion Music, three players (1935) • Suite for chamber orchestra (1934–5) • Intermezzo for orchestra (1936 - 2nd movement of Symphony, below) • Symphony No. 1 (1942) • Overland Trail, orchestral overture (1943) • Symphony No. 2 (1946–7) • Violin Sonata (1949) • Concerto Grosso for sextet (1950) • Three Whitman Excerpts for chorus (1950) • Violin Concerto (1951) • Cello Concerto, with woodwind quartet and piano (1951) • Compusition, series of 10 pieces for computer and tape (1969–72) • Synthions, series of nine pieces for tape (1969–72) • Synclavions series of four pieces for synthesizer (1983) ==References==
